About 24 Adamsrill Close
24 Adamsrill Close is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Enfield (EN1 2BP). It has a recorded floor area of 77 m² (around 829 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band D. At 77 m² this is the largest unit on EPC record across the building (35–77 m²). The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the bottom. The latest certificate (September 2024) shows a D (score 61),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since October 2009. Between certificates, lighting went from Very Poor to Very Good; while window ef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 78).
Held since July 2009 — that's 17 years off the open market, well above the local norm. That sale fell during the post-crash dip, which often skews comparisons against later neighbouring sales. Today's modelled estimate of £330,000 sits 153.8% above the 2009 sale of £130,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£157/sq ft) was about 45.3% below the postcode norm. At 77 m² it's 29.4% larger than the typical home in the postcode (60 m² median across 18 EPCs).
